Rocket solid propulsion refers to a propulsion system that uses solid propellant, where the fuel and oxidizer are combined into a solid grain. Upon ignition, the solid propellant burns from the inside out, generating high-pressure gas that is expelled through a nozzle to produce thrust.

The primary types of rocket solid propulsion include boosters, upper stages, and in-space propulsion systems. Boosters are high-thrust rocket engines, typically solid-fueled, that provide the initial thrust to launch a rocket and are discarded once their fuel is exhausted. Rocket types include launch vehicles, spacecraft propulsion, and military rockets, with common propellant types such as ammonium perchlorate composite propellant (APCP), hydroxyl-terminated polybutadiene (HTPB), and polyurethane (PU). These systems are employed in a wide range of applications, including earth observation, navigation, communication, and space exploration, and are used by government agencies, commercial companies, and research institutions.

Tariffs have increased manufacturing costs in the rocket solid propulsion market by raising prices for imported materials such as composite casings, propellant chemicals, and precision ignition components, leading to delays in supply chains and higher procurement budgets. Defense and commercial launch operators in major aerospace regions including North America, Europe, and Asia-Pacific are the most affected. However, tariffs have also encouraged regional manufacturing expansion, fostering domestic supply chain development and technological self-reliance for solid propulsion systems.

The rocket solid propulsion market size has grown steadily in recent years. It will grow from $307.91 billion in 2025 to $320.61 billion in 2026 at a compound annual growth rate (CAGR) of 4.1%. The growth in the historic period can be attributed to widespread use of solid propellants in military and space rockets, advancements in grain formulation and combustion stability, expansion of defense and space research programs, development of reliable ignition and control systems, increased production of solid propulsion motors for tactical and strategic applications.

The rocket solid propulsion market size is expected to see steady growth in the next few years. It will grow to $376.37 billion in 2030 at a compound annual growth rate (CAGR) of 4.1%. The growth in the forecast period can be attributed to rising demand for high-thrust solid rocket motors in defense and aerospace, focus on environmentally safer and stable propellant compositions, integration of advanced guidance and control systems, growth in commercial space launch activities using solid propulsion, development of modular and versatile solid rocket motor designs. Major trends in the forecast period include advancements in high-energy solid propellants, adoption of lightweight composite motor casings, increased demand for multi-stage solid boosters, growth in commercial satellite launch services, enhanced safety and quality assurance standards.

The increasing number of satellite launches is expected to drive the growth of the rocket solid propulsion market in the coming years. Satellite launches involve sending artificial satellites into space for applications such as communication, navigation, scientific research, and Earth observation. This rise in launch activity is largely fueled by the growing need for enhanced communication capabilities, as satellites improve global connectivity and support faster, more reliable data transmission for internet, television, and telecommunications-especially in remote or underserved regions. Solid rocket propulsion plays a critical role in satellite deployment by providing the necessary thrust, stability, and reliability required to accurately position satellites into their designated orbits. For example, according to the Government Accountability Office, a U.S.-based government agency, as of spring 2022, nearly 5,500 active satellites were in orbit, with projections indicating that an additional 58,000 could be launched by 2030. Therefore, the increasing volume of satellite launches is contributing significantly to the expansion of the rocket solid propulsion market.

Major companies in the rocket solid propulsion market are advancing innovative products such as solid propellant rockets to improve launch efficiency and reduce mission costs. A solid propellant rocket uses a pre-mixed solid fuel and oxidizer packed into the combustion chamber, which ignites to generate thrust during launch. For instance, in June 2023, Guangzhou Zhongke Aerospace Exploration Technology Co., Ltd., a China-based commercial space launch provider, successfully launched its largest solid-propellant rocket, Lijian-1, deploying 26 satellites into orbit in a single mission. This achievement demonstrated enhanced launch efficiency and lower mission costs enabled by solid propulsion technology. The flight was the second mission for Lijian-1, highlighting the growing reliability and maturity of its propulsion system. The rocket incorporated breakthroughs in six key technologies and utilized 13 domestic innovations for the first time, underscoring China's progress in solid carrier rocket development.

In June 2023, Anduril Industries Inc., a U.S.-based defense and space manufacturing company, acquired Adranos for an undisclosed amount. This acquisition is intended to strengthen the U.S. solid rocket motor supply base by fostering competition, expanding the industrial supply chain, and accelerating the development and production of advanced solid propulsion systems for defense applications. Adranos Inc. is a U.S.-based manufacturer specializing in solid rocket motors and solid rocket propulsion technologies.
